So here’s my story:
Born & Raised in the Central Valley of California, In the mid 1970's I moved to the Bay Area bound for college, eventually married and started a family, in 1980 my husband and his dad embarked on building the family's vacation home on Lake Tulloch. For 10 years we were "weekenders" at the lake, but somewhere along the line we had became locals and part of the community of Copperopolis, every Sunday was painful, we loved the foothill lifestyle and never wanted to leave to the hustle and bustle of the Bay Area but work called. In 1990 we made a life changing decision and decided that the time had come, our son's were young and we were going to raise them in Copperopolis, a decision we have never looked back on in 28 years.
Thus my Real Estate Career was born...shortly after moving to "Copper" I was hired at a local real estate office as an assistant, one year later I got my Real Estate license and was off and running. Real Estate in the foothills is unique from a Realtor's point of view; you need a knowledge of a wide area (not a subdivision) a whole county or two. Eventually I earned my Brokers license and am currently a Broker Associate for Bradley & Brown Realty Serving the Lake Tulloch / Copperopolis area.
Raising two sons here has truly been a blessing, they share our love of the outdoors and all that this area has to offer, so much so that after moving away for college they returned to their home town of Copperopolis where they eventually married became homeowners and graced me with my wonderful grandchildren.
